Frontpage wrote: ReactOS® is a free, modern operating system based on the design of Windows® XP/2003. Written completely from scratch, it aims to follow the Windows® architecture designed by Microsoft from the hardware level right through to the application level. This is not a Linux based system, and shares none of the unix architecture.

ReactOS aims to be a functioning clone of Windows NT, just as Linux cloned UNIX. Thus, the kernel will be a functioning clone of the Windows NT kernel. The GUI is not KDE or Gnome, but a new one written from scratch. The current GUI is rather buggy, though, and is aimed to be replaced with a new one (explorer_new, if you look in the ReactOS directory) when we hit 0.4.0. As a Linux and BSD user, you should be familiar with Wine. Whereas Wine is a compatibility layer, translating Windows calls into Linux calls to run Windows applications, ReactOS aims to implement the entire Windows operating system. This will allow us to run Windows applications and drivers. The goal is that if it runs in Windows, it should run in ReactOS.

However, many of the security issues with Windows are not as much architectural issues but issues with implementation. For example, the many instances where Internet Explorer was used to as a backdoor to break Windows, and setting all profiles in Windows XP as Administrator by default. While ultimately ReactOS may become vulnerable to the same viruses as a Windows install, the way ReactOS is implemented should help deter it.

ReactOS is currently alpha-build software. I wouldn't bet on anti-virus or firewall software to work just yet, though you may have some luck. I also would suggest running it in a virtual machine as opposed to real hardware if you really want to get a feel for ReactOS, as the hardware support isn't the greatest right now.
